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• Whether the Council's decision to refuse the certificate of lawful use was well-founded

What decided it

The appellant's voluminous and consistent documentary evidence, including tenancy agreements, bank statements, statutory declarations, and government correspondence, clearly demonstrated conversion to 5 self-contained flats by July 2020 and continuous residential use thereafter, which the Council failed to contradict with specific cogent evidence.
